Yusai Bekkan

Yusai Bekkan

10/10 Excellent
"Clean and spacious traditional style room. Toilet was somehow a bit too small though, not particularly comfortable to use. Basin (for hand washing after using toilet) was then on the other side of the room which was a bit inconvenient. Hot spring facilities were at a different building (much newer and modern) which were 2 mins walk away. That was a slight problem when it was raining heavily when we were there. Parking was not great for our bigger car (RAV4 size type SUV). Tight space and lot of guests made parking very difficult. During golden week, when we stayed there, dining options at night were very limited in nearby regions."
